Belarus hosts national statistical system assessment mission

MINSK, 17 June (BelTA) – Belarus' National Statistics Committee is hosting the first mission of Global Assessment of the National Statistical System, BelTA learned from the National Statistics Committee.

The organizer is the statistical office of the European Union. The experts of this office, and also the UN Economic Commission for Europe, the European Free Trade Association and independent experts will stay in Belarus till 21 June to examine the structure and organization of the national statistical system.

The experts will undertake an in-depth review of the statistical laws, observance of the fundamental principles of official statistics and the European statistics code. The mission will take into account the implementation of the quality management system, the use of human, financial and IT resources. Experts will pay attention to production processes, dissemination of statistical information, communication with key users, staff development, and international cooperation and will undertake an in-depth review of multi-sectoral statistics and statistics across certain areas: business, agriculture, macroeconomic and socio-demographic statistics.

International experts will meet with other producers of official statistics, users of official statistical information, representatives of the scientific and academic community, media, international organizations in Belarus.

A detailed report and recommendations on priority areas of development of the national statistical system will be prepared following the global assessment.

Previous adapted global assessments were conducted in Belarus in October 2012 and March 2013.
